Contract Works Insurance provides cover for any physical damage of works or third party liabilities during construction stages of a project. Most construction contracts contain provisions which require insurance to be taken out to cover physical damage and/or loss of the works—such insurance is  Contract works insurance is an insurance for builders and other tradesmen, designed to cover work that’s underway on a site. It can pay to repair or redo the work that’s in progress if it’s damaged by an insured event like fire, flood, storm, vandalism or theft. Contract works insurance UK, sometimes called contractor’s all risks insurance policy, is a vital type of insurance for people who are operating in the construction sector. It covers a range of different types of property on the construction site against damage or losses due to theft or vandalism. Contract works insurance is can provide cover on either a per-project, or annual basis. It is primarily designed for business owners operating their own projects rather than subcontractors. A Contract Works Insurance policy will generally cover the contractor, any sub-contractors and any other parties associated with a specific contract.
